One-pot combustion synthesis of Li3VO4-Li4Ti5O12 nanocomposite as anode material of lithium-ion batteries with improved performance

© 2016 Elsevier LtdLi3VO4-decorated Li4Ti5O12 (denoted as V-LTO) composites were synthesized via a facile one-pot cellulose-assisted combustion route.
